BREAKING: The worst is confirmed for Rafaël Harvey-Pinard and his replacement is revealed
Following the terrible sequence we were talking about a few minutes ago.
Here, the worst is confirmed for Rafaël Harvey-Pinard. Not only is his injury confirmed, but it seems to be his right ankle again.
"The CH confirms to us that Rafaël Harvey-Pinard will not return in this game. We are talking about a lower body injury, probably the right ankle.
Let's remember he missed 24 games this season due to a right ankle injury." - Patrick Friolet, RDS
Yes, it looks very bad...
"Forward Rafaël Harvey-Pinard will not return to the game this afternoon (lower body)." - Montreal Canadiens
Martin St-Louis offers a promotion to Brandon Gignac, who is designated to replace Harvey-Pinard (who is injured)
An opportunity for him to seize.
"Unsurprisingly, the Canadiens announce that RHP will not return to the game today.
Brandon Gignac took his place on the penalty kill." - Marc Antoine Godin
Gignac also took his regular spot at 5 on 5.
